The spores of mold are everywhere in the air, only becoming visible when conditions are acceptable to it, and the fungus finds an appropriate surface to colonize. The fungus usually opts for shadowy and moist spaces. Among other assistance, your professional mold inspector will identify the source of the moisture – whether it's from recent flooding or leaks – to help you develop a strategy for remediation. Mold can be almost any color, including red, green, yellow, white, and black, which is typically associated with a particularly harmful species, Stachybotrys chartarum, known to induce dangerous health effects in some individuals and animals.

Though mold is not dangerous for the majority of people, it does cause serious cosmetic issues and a stale odor. Even worse, the fungus eats the surfaces that it colonizes, damaging materials and weakening the structural stability of a building over time. It feeds on cellulose materials that are ubiquitous in just about every home, including:

  • Drywall
  • Wood
  • Carpet
  • Insulation
  • Ceiling tiles
  • Wallpaper
  • Fabrics
  • Upholstery
  • Some Painted surfaces
  • Paper
  • Cardboard
  • And More

Some aspects in how your mold inspector performs testing may vary with each home, but will usually involve the following:

  • Initial Assessment: The mold inspector accumulates information about the property, any noted mold issues, and your apprehensions during the initial consultation to devise a plan for mold testing.
  • Visual Inspection: The next step of our mold inspection service includes a thorough visual examination of the property, both inside and out, seeking for signs of mold growth, water intrusion, and other moisture-related problems. We investigate areas prone to mold infestation, like subterranean levels, crawl spaces, bathrooms, attics, and rooms with plumbing or heating and cooling systems.
  • Moisture detection: Advanced tools like moisture meters, thermal cameras, or hygrometers may be employed to detect hidden moisture within building materials, such as walls, floors, and ceilings, that could promote the spread of mold.
  • Air Sampling: Mold testing may necessitate air samples to be extracted from different areas of the home using special equipment. The air samples will be dispatched to a lab for assessment to confirm the type and concentration of mold spores existing in the air.
  • Surface Sampling: The inspector may also obtain surface samples from portions of the home where the fungus is suspected. These samples will be dispatched to a lab for assessment to confirm the type of mold existing.
  • Documentation and Reporting: The mold inspector prepares a thorough report summarizing their discoveries. The report usually includes data on areas of mold growth, moisture sources, types of mold present (if detected), and suggestions for mitigation or further actions.
  • Recommendations and Remediation Plan: Depending on the inspection results, the inspector gives advice to address the mold issues and halt further growth.
  • Follow-up and Clearance Testing: After remediation efforts, the inspector may execute a secondary examination to ensure that the mold problem has been adequately addressed. Validation testing may be performed to verify that the indoor environment meets permissible mold spore levels and is safe for occupants.
  • Education and Prevention: The inspector guides the client about mold prevention measures, including proper air circulation, humidity management, and maintenance practices.

What Do I Have To Do To Prepare for the Mold Inspection?

You can adhere to a few easy rules to assist your mold inspector in performing a thorough and complete home inspection. Activities to refrain from include preparing food, smoking, using chemical cleaners, or employing air filtration systems to prevent interfering with air readings that your mold inspector may take.

You should make sure of clear access to locations that your mold inspector is going to need to access by removing clutter and hindrances that may impede the inspection. Moreover, supply pertinent information about any past water incidents or plumbing problems in the home. It's also helpful to document areas of concern with pictures or notes to assist in potential remediation measures.
